Student advances in business competition

A Whitewater High DECA Club member has qualified to compete in the Virtual Business Challenge finals at the DECA International Career and Development Conference in April in Anaheim, Calif.

Glenn MacDonald competed in the retailing track of the challenge, taking first place in Georgia and sixth place in the nation.

The DECA Virtual Business Challenge is an official DECA competitive event where participants use visual simulation software to manage a business, testing their management skills against other students across the United States. Participants manage specific marketing and business concepts such as pricing, staffing, merchandising, market research, and promotion. Competitors are ranked based on their store’s cumulative profit after running the simulation for one virtual year.

MacDonald and other challengers at the international conference will play the live simulation in front of an audience. It will be a double elimination tournament where the participants will compete for a grand prize of $1,000 plus $6,000 to cover their airfare and hotel expenses.
